Data gets zapped by an arc of electricity in a jefferies tube and begins instructing Riker on how to remove his head. The next time we see him Riker has hooked him up to a console in Engineering.

No implication is really given either way if Data was "awake" during the transit to Engieering but it seems to me that we're supposed to take it Data was "awake" during the trip, as there some stuff with Riker needing to hook Data up to the computer.

Data's head could work independantly from his body, his head having a limited local powersource and containing all of his memories, processors, etc. Hs "body" mostly consisting of the mechanics for motion and his primary powersouce.
